Is there a teaching styles inventory that parallels the ILS?

0

None has been developed. If teachers look at the list of recommended teaching strategies in “Learning and Teaching Styles in Engineering Education,” they should be able to judge the extent to which they are addressing the needs of students with different learning styles.
